发明名称 INTERMETALLIC COMPOUND TIAL-BASE LIGHTWEIGHT HEAT-RESISTING ALLOY
摘要 PURPOSE:To improve the cold ductility of the title alloy without impairing the excellent high temp. strength of TiAl by specifying the compsn. of Ti and Al into two-phase structure and incorporating specific amounts of Nb, etc., thereto. CONSTITUTION:The lightweight heat-resisting alloy contains, by weight, 30-36% Al and one kind among 0.5-15% Nb, 0.1-4% Cr and 0.1-6% Mo, contains, at need, one or more kinds among 0.01-0.5% B, C and Si and the balance Ti. Or, the alloy is constituted of the above Al, B, etc., and 0.1-8% V and the balance consisting of Ti. In the alloy, (TiAl+Ti3Al) consisting essentially of TiAl is regulated to its base and to which stabilizing elements such as Nb are added to facilitate the generation of twins. In the alloy, at the time of <=30% Al content, the volume of Ti3Al is made too large to lower high temp. strength and cold ductility. As for Nb, Cr, Mo or V, the addition of the lower limit or the above is required to improve its cold ductility; in the case of the upper limit or the above, normal ductility is lowered as for the Cr content, and high temp. strength is lowered as for the other elements.
